How they compare

Lao People's Democratic Republic currently reports 28.6% against 28.3% in Eswatini, a difference of 0.3%.

Across all 24 years both countries report, Lao People's Democratic Republic has been ahead every year.

Eswatini ranks 79th and Lao People's Democratic Republic ranks 77th of 192 countries.

Lao People's Democratic Republic has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Eswatini Lao People's Democratic Republic Difference Ahead
2000s 27.0% 33.9% 6.9% Lao People's Democratic Republic
2010s 24.1% 29.9% 5.8% Lao People's Democratic Republic
2020s 26.9% 28.4% 1.4% Lao People's Democratic Republic

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
